Jake Rusher Park
Jake Rusher Park, located at 132 State Road 3174 in Arden, North Carolina, is a historic institution with a rich past. Originally part of the Royal Pines neighborhood, the park was once home to the Royal Pines Club, Recreation Center, Pool, and Skateboard Park owned by Jake Rusher. This popular hangout spot hosted performances by famous artists such as The Supremes, the Isley Brothers, and Bo Diddley. In 1999, Rusher donated the land to the City of Asheville, leading to the transformation of the park into a community space. Recent improvements include a pavilion, restroom building, sport courts, playground, and accessible sidewalks. The park also offers programming for children, teens, and adults, with scholarships available for youth and teen programs.

Vietnam Veterans Park
Vietnam Veterans Park, located at 760 Orphanage Road in Concord, North Carolina, is a popular tourist attraction and park managed by Active Living and Parks (ALPs). ALPs aims to enhance the quality of life for Cabarrus County residents through fitness, wellness, and education. The park features a variety of amenities, including the area's first mountain bike course and skills trail, tennis courts, miniature golf course, paddle boats, softball and soccer fields, a swim pool, nature and bike trails, outdoor fitness equipment, and fishing ponds. Additionally, there are two active living centers that offer classes and clubs for all levels of activity, as well as special events for those 50 years old and above.

John Chavis Memorial Park
John Chavis Memorial Park, located at 505 Martin Luther King Junior Boulevard in Raleigh, North Carolina, is a historic park and tourist attraction that has been a staple in the community since 1937. Home to the Allan Herschell No. 2 Special Three-Abreast Carousel, this park was added to the National Register of Historic Places in 2016. The park features a half-mile section of the Capital Area Greenway Trail, making it a great spot for outdoor activities and leisurely walks. The park underwent a recent renovation, which includes the beautiful "Chavis Reclaimed" artwork glass collage by artist David Wilson. The community center at John Chavis Memorial Park offers various rooms for rent, including a fitness room with state-of-the-art equipment and a stunning view of the downtown skyline.
Eliza Pool Park
Eliza Pool Park is a historic park located at 1600 Fayetteville Street in Raleigh, North Carolina. This park is not only a beautiful outdoor space but also a significant tourist attraction due to its rich history. The park is situated on the former site of the Eliza Pool School, which operated from 1924 to 1980. It is named after Eliza Pool, a dedicated educator who taught in Wake County Schools from 1886 to 1926. Visitors can enjoy the park's lush greenery, walking paths, and recreational facilities while also learning about the legacy of Eliza Pool and the school that once stood on this site.
